Scottish smallpipes in A / D
A / D COMBINATION SET in Madagascan rosewood with boxwood and brass fittings
2 chanters A and D with interchangeable stocks
drones A, a, D, d
4 drone switches
Tuning bead on small drone together with drone switches permits the following drone tunings:
A a e, A E a
D a d, A D a
Hide bag
Bellows included
